Non-Shocker of the Day: Trump Cheats on His Taxes (and Grifts the RNC)

Taking a double deduction on a Chicago project to the tune of $100 million in tax evasion.

Former President Donald Trump may face an IRS bill in excess of $100 million after a government audit indicates he double-dipped on tax losses tied to a Chicago skyscraper, according to a report by The New York Times and ProPublica that drew on a yearslong audit and public filings.
